In 2018, the voters of Oklahoma made their voices heard and State Question 788 was approved to allow a legal medical marijuana program. There are a few important ways that Oklahoma differs from other states in how its medical marijuana program is run. How is Oklahoma Different?

Phil Murphy signed legislation into law today significantly amending and expanding the state’s medical cannabis access program. Assembly Bill 20 , The Jake Honig Compassionate Use Medical Cannabis Act, institutes various changes to the program to better facilitate patients’ access to the substance.

Kansas is one of only 14 states without a comprehensive medical marijuana program, currently allowing patients with a recommendation from a physician to only use CBD oil with a maximum of 5% THC. To qualify for the program, patients would need a recommendation from a physician specially certified by the state to make such recommendations.

Medical marijuana was legalized in Maryland in 2014, but the MD MMJ program was slow to get off the ground. The Maryland MMJ program is one of the newer programs in the US, but once it started, it quickly became one of the fastest-growing MMJ programs in the country. Iowa’s medical marijuana program began in 2014. It was a very limited program and patients were only allowed access to low-THC preparations. The program was expanded in 2017 and 2020, and now patients can purchase higher-THC preparations in various forms. Can I Buy Edibles In Iowa? Does Iowa Have Any Dispensaries?
